
The AirTAC Airtac SAUF Series Valve-Mounted Air Cylinder SAUF32X75S-06B is a genuine double-acting profile-type cylinder with a Ø32mm bore, 75mm stroke and a built-in 4M210-06 5/2 solenoid valve — it switches itself from one coil signal, so no separate remote valve or extra plumbing is needed.
The AirTAC SAUF32X75S-06B is a double-acting profile cylinder with a built-in 4M210 5/2 solenoid valve on the cap. One coil signal drives the actuator, eliminating remote plumbing and saving a manifold slot. The extruded aluminum barrel is shorter than an ISO 15552 cylinder of the same bore. This 32 mm bore has a 1/8" cylinder port, an M10x1.25 rod thread, and 21 mm adjustable cushions.
Operating in the 0.15-0.8 MPa valve window, it delivers 402 N push and 345 N pull at 0.5 MPa. The 4M210-06 valve flows 14 mm2 (Cv 0.78) at up to 5 cycles/s. With a DC24V terminal coil (IP65, <=0.05 s response), the safe working load is roughly 241 N, allowing a 20 kg vertical lift with a 2:1 margin. The -S suffix adds a piston magnet for CMSG/DMSG/EMSG switches.

SAUF does not hold its load without air — the valve routes air, it is not a lock. For a held load, add an external rod lock or a pilot-operated check valve.

Size between neighbours: the 32 mm bore gives 402 N push at 0.5 MPa, while the next size up (40 mm) provides 628 N. This SAUF32X75S-06B uses a DC24V terminal entry coil. The rod retracts when energised; reposition the valve to extend on signal. Size force within the 0.15-0.8 MPa valve range, not the 1.0 MPa cylinder body rating. The valve routes air and is not a lock—add an external rod lock or pilot-operated check valve to hold loads. For the 75 mm stroke, standard guide rules apply; add side-load guidance for strokes over 300 mm.
